The key differences between the NIV Bible and the NKJV lie in their translation methods. The NIV aims for a more modern and readable language, while the NKJV maintains a more literal approach to the original text. These differences can impact the interpretation of scripture by influencing how the text is understood in terms of clarity, accuracy, and cultural relevance.

The main difference between SJR and Impact Factor is the way they measure the impact of research publications. SJR considers the prestige of the journals where the research is published and the citations received, while Impact Factor focuses solely on the number of citations a journal receives. SJR provides a more nuanced and comprehensive evaluation of a publication's impact compared to Impact Factor.
